It was thought that the lighthouse, erected in 1881 to overlook the Wellfleet, Mass., harbor had been dismantled and destroyed in 1925. Recently discovered records reveal that the lighthouse at Point Montara, California, is the very same. It was removed from Wellfleet harbor by the U.S. Coast Guard but there are no records indicating how it was moved.
